adjective
- sufficient in quantity or quality to meet a requirement or need
- barely satisfactory or acceptable; not outstanding
Examples
- The hotel room was adequate for our short stay.
- She has adequate skills for the job but lacks experience.
- The budget provides adequate funding for basic needs.
- His performance was adequate, though not exceptional.
- We need adequate time to complete the project properly.
- The shelter provided adequate protection from the storm.
- Her explanation was adequate to answer most questions.
